Crux is the capital markets platform changing the way clean energy and manufacturing projects are financed in the U.S. Crux’s platform, market intelligence, and expert team help developers and manufacturers unlock financing through all stages of project development and operation.

Our team of 50+ is composed of experts in energy, tax, finance, government, and technology. We have raised $77 million in capital from some of the best investors, including Andreessen Horowitz, Lowercarbon Capital, New System Ventures, Overture, Ardent Venture Partners, QED, Canapi, and others. These funds are joined by strategic investors including Pattern Energy, Clearway Energy, EDF Renewables, Intersect Power, LS Power, Orsted, Hartree Partners, Liberty Mutual Strategic Ventures, MassMutual Ventures, and OMERS Ventures.

An inflection point in American energy and manufacturing.

Energy demand is growing for the first time in 20 years, driven by surging manufacturing, transportation, electrification, and data centers. Simultaneously, hundreds of billions of dollars are being invested in domestic supply chains for critical minerals and components. Developers and manufacturers will require trillions of dollars in capital to meet growing needs.

Without Crux, the capital markets supporting this transformation remain opaque, fragmented, and complex. We recognized the missing infrastructure: a central capital markets platform designed specifically for the next century of American energy and industry. By connecting counterparties, providing market intelligence, and streamlining transactions, we unlock faster decision making, lower cost of capital, and accelerated investment.

The Opportunity

We’re seeking an experienced Events and Community Lead to design, manage, and scale a high-impact events program that strengthens Crux’s brand, builds lasting industry relationships, and drives measurable business results. This role combines strategic planning with hands-on execution, owning every detail of our presence at 50+ conferences and trade shows annually, as well as branded experiences, partner activations, and a steady cadence of webinars.

You’ll be responsible for creating memorable, on-brand experiences that connect with our target audiences across the clean energy finance industry, from intimate executive dinners to multi-day enterprise gatherings. This is a high-visibility role for a creative operator who thrives in a fast-paced, scrappy environment, has exceptional taste and vendor management skills, and is excited to work at the intersection of climate, technology, and finance.

Key Responsibilities

Conference and trade show management

  • Own end-to-end logistics for Crux’s presence at 50+ events annually, including booth design and production, vendor coordination, shipping, and team attendance.

  • Manage all registrations, speaking submissions, and related deadlines to maximize visibility and engagement.

  • Develop pre- and post-event processes for meeting scheduling, lead capture, follow-up, and ROI reporting.

Branded event production

Plan and execute Crux-branded experiences, ranging from intimate executive dinners to large-scale multi-day events.

Lead venue sourcing, vendor negotiations, budget management, and on-site execution.

Ensure all experiences align with Crux’s brand voice and high aesthetic standards.

Co-hosted partner events

  • Collaborate with strategic partners to co-produce events (dinners, happy hours, workshops, etc.) that drive joint value.

  • Coordinate shared responsibilities, budgets, and post-event follow-up to strengthen partnerships.

Webinar program

  • Produce and manage approximately two monthly webinars, including topic planning, speaker selection & preparation, and technical setup.

  • Track and report performance metrics to refine approach.

Swag and gifting management

  • Oversee design, production, and distribution of Crux-branded merchandise and client gifts with an eye for detail, quality, and style.

  • Manage multiple vendors to ensure timely delivery, cost control, and strong brand representation.

Event operations and process improvement

  • Build and maintain a scalable event operations playbook.

  • Implement systems for tracking budgets, timelines, vendor contracts, and ROI.

  • Identify and adopt tools that improve efficiency and attendee experience.

Required qualifications

  • 5+ years in events, field marketing, or experiential marketing in high-growth or B2B settings.
